The first objective of SIMPLE project was achieved within the first reporting period: the SpaceFibre (SpFi) IP-core design is now complete and the IP-core is currently part of IngeniArs products portfolio, ready for the commercialization. The SpFi IP-core is used as a building block for the other two products comprised in SIMPLE: the SpFi Analyser Box and the SpFi Analyser PXI. The development of the SpFi Analyser Box and the SpFi Analyser PXI, which represents the second and third objective of SIMPLE respectively, has been closed during the second reporting period. These devices serve as reference equipment for testing and validating any design/product related to SpFi and are therefore key components for the development of such technology. In addition, IngeniArs organized on 24th April 2018 an international Workshop in Pisa titled “The present and the future of high-speed interfaces for satellite on-board data systems”. The aim of the workshop was to promote SIMPLE project, SpaceFibre diffusion over Europe and demonstrate IngeniArs commitment to SpaceFibre technology. Several institutions, such as ASI and ESA, and big players of the aerospace market joined the workshop.
